Aerobic exercise increases neurogenesis (growth of new neurons) in the hippocamps, improwises serotonin andd dopamine regulation, and reduces cortisol. It also stimulates the release of brady-derived neurotrophic factor (BDNF), a protein that supports synaptic plasticy andd helps the brain adaft to stress. A 30- minute brisk walk, jog, or bike ride cane can shit brain activity fem DMNT to thee taske taske -positiva network, breaking the ruminoatin cyle cyle.

Nutrition and- Gut- Brain Axis

Te gut- brain axis is a two- way communication system between the gut microbiome and thee central nervoos system. Diets rich in processed foods and sugar can promote efficulation, which feffects neurotransmitter production and brain function. Conversele, a diet high in omegae acids (found in fish), probiotis (yourt, fermented foods), and antioksydantis (berries, dark foli grenes) supportty healty serotonin and BDDF levels.
